Logistics & Procurement Coordinator - Denver, United States - Sweet Cow
Description
Job DescriptionJob Description Salary:
$20 per hour. Opportunity to participate in 50% employer-paid health benefits & 401k for hourly employees who average over 30 hours per week. We provide paid sick leave as required by the HFWA.
POSITION DESCRIPTION
Job Title:
Logistics & Procurement Coordinator
Reports To:
Facilities, Logistics, and Procurement Manager

And you're looking for an opportunity to learn, grow and explore your career potential.RESPONSIBILITIES
Operation and upkeep of our fleet delivery vehicles
Execute all aspects of ice cream and product delivery, including invoicing and product rotation
Execute all aspects of weekly ingredient procurement, including shopping and delivery
Effectively understand, use and update proprietary ice cream inventory management software
Maintain cleanliness and organization of storage areas and fleet vehicles
Clearly communicate needs or issues with shop managers and field support team
Greet customers to make them feel comfortable and welcome
Demonstrate knowledge of the brand and menu items
Check quality and temperatures throughout the day to ensure Sweet Cow quality and safety standards are met or exceeded
Follow sanitation and safety procedures in regard to food handling
Work as a team to ensure shop needs are met
Act with integrity, honesty and knowledge that promotes the culture of Sweet Cow
Maintain regular and consistent attendance and punctuality
Contribute to a positive team environment
Work in "in-shop" production and service roles as needed
KNOWLEDGE/SKILLS/REQUIREMENTS
Spotless driving record
Impeccable organization and planning skills
Ability to work with minimal supervision
Ability to quickly and effectively manage and execute change
Mastery of basic arithmetic, fractions, decimals, percents, ratios and both English units of measurement and the metric system
Attention to detail and accuracy
Excellent customer service skills required
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
Team oriented, adaptable, dependable, and strong work ethic
Ability to communicate effectively with customers and team members
Ability to lift up to 50 pounds
Daytime availability
Ability to work a minimum of 30 hours per week
Ability to work nights, weekends and holidays
Must be at least 18 years of age
EXPERIENCE
Previous service industry and logistics experience preferred
